How to Choose the Right Oven and Hob for Your Kitchen

If you're looking for an oven or a new hob, we've got the sizes, features and styles to suit your kitchen.

Solid plate hobs are easy to use and are durable. They are made of metal with a sealed surface that heats your cookware. These are good for flat-based products and can be cost-effective to run.

Functions

The oven functions, also referred to as cooking modes, are preprogrammed settings that control the oven's heating element as well as fan depending on your recipe. They are designed to make cooking food more simple and more efficient, while preserving the flavor and texture.

Ovens come with a traditional mode that heats food from the top to the bottom. There is also a fan-assisted option that uses an integrated fan to circulate air around the oven, allowing for an even and faster heating. There are many different types of oven and hob functions to choose from, built-in oven and it's essential to know the various options to figure out the ones that are best for your requirements.

The fan-powered function of the oven is ideal for cooking a range of food items. It heats the oven more evenly than conventional ovens and is ideal for grilling, baking, and roasting. It is especially helpful for pizzas and pie that require a fast, smooth finish. The Fan-Assisted setting features a zigzag at the top and a line on the bottom. It can save up to 40 percent of cooking time.

Some ovens come with grilling features that combine the heat from the bottom of the oven with that from the top, giving your meals an amazing char. This is a great option for meat and vegetable kebabs and can be marked by zigzag lines and straight lines, like Fan-Assisted. This type of oven is usually used on the bottom rack of the oven, so make careful to observe the oven's temperature settings to prevent overcooking.

Other oven functions include slow cooking baking, proofing bread and pastries, and more. These are usually preprogrammed and provide a controlled warm environment to help rise dough and develop flavors.

Some ovens come with steam functions that are ideal for making healthy and nutritious meals. It adds a small amount of moisture to your food, which preserves tenderness and adds a delicate, rich taste to your poultry, vegetables, baked goods and even custards. Utilizing this feature is just as simple as pouring the water into the reservoir in your oven and turning it on, with some models even automatically adjusting the amount of steam based on the temperature you select.

Types

There are a variety of ovens and hobs available that are available, ranging from traditional gas to modern electric models. Picking the one that best oven uk suits your requirements and preferences can make a big difference to how it is easy to cook at home. It is worth considering features like self-cleaning or intelligent capabilities too.

Gas ovens are suitable for many kitchens and are a popular choice. They are easy to use since they come with rings on the burners and an grate on which pans rest and emits heat. Gas hobs also tend to be energy efficient and offer precise temperature control, meaning they can reduce your energy bills. They can take longer to heat up than electric hobs and can be more difficult to clean with dirt.

Electric hobs are available in a variety of styles including induction and ceramic. Induction hobs are a little more expensive to purchase but are considered to be energy efficient since the hob only generates heat when you place a pan over it. They are also safe for children and are able to heat quite quickly. They are also slow to cool down and don't warm up evenly.

Plate hobs are another stalwart of the kitchen, offering an array of electric cooking zones on flat surfaces that are placed beneath your kitchen units. They sport a sleek, modern look that will complement the majority of kitchens. They can be difficult to keep clean as they contain multiple cooking zones, which can cause uneven heating and can leave burn marks on the surface if they are not properly cleaned.

Single ovens with built-in ovens are the most common kind of oven, and can be placed under a hob and oven or above the eye level in a built-In oven unit. They are usually large enough to accommodate a big meal and come in a variety of sizes, so make certain to consider your family's size when you choose an oven. They can also be found with additional options such as a grill or a steam function.

Installation

If you're planning to install a new oven or replacing one you have, it might be worthwhile to hire an electrician to handle the installation for you. This will ensure the electrical circuit is properly installed and that your new oven is safe to use. A qualified electrician can follow local regulations to ensure your installation is compliant with all safety regulations.

Before you begin the process of fitting your new electric oven or hob you'll need all the necessary supplies and tools on hand. Wire nuts as well as a screwdriver and electrical tape are among the tools you'll need. It's also important to check the electrical supply in your home to ensure it is able to handle the load of a new electric oven and hob.

The first step in the process of putting in a new stove and oven is to get rid of any old appliances. To do this, locate the bolts or screws that hold the old appliance in place and then remove them carefully. After the appliance has been removed, the area where the new one will be installed should be clear of obstructions. The junction box needs to be mounted, and the conduit connected to the electrical supply. It is crucial to follow the instructions of the manufacturer as well as any local regulations.

Once the electrical connections are established and the oven or hob is connected, it is then lowered into place. The fitter will utilize the clips that came along with the hob in order to secure it and ensure it's flush with your worktop. The fitter will then test the hob and oven and make sure that it's operating correctly.

It is recommended to hire an expert to install a gas stove and oven. Gas installation isn't as easy as plugging in an electric oven. A CORGI registered engineer must connect the pipes. It's also recommended to purchase a cooker hood installed in case you don't have one, as it will help to ventilate your kitchen and is required by Part F of the Building Regulations.
